Ogun police arrests suspected kidnapper of journalist

Operatives of the Ogun State Police Command on March 24, arrested one of the suspects who abducted a journalist at the Mobalufon area of Ijebu Ode on March 9.

The spokesperson of the police command, SP Abimbola Oyeyemi, said the suspect, 41 year old Temidayo Oladimeji, was arrested following a painstaking technical and intelligence-based investigation embarked upon by SP Taiwo Opadiran led anti-kidnapping team, which led them to the suspect’s hideout where he had been hibernating.

LIB had earlier reported that a journalist, Oduneye Olusegun was abducted by three gunmen at Mobalufon area of Ijebu Ode on the 9th of March 2023, consequence upon which policemen attached to Obalende divisional headquarters traced the kidnappers to Idimu area of Lagos, where they engaged the hoodlums in gun battle. At the end of the encounter, the kidnappers escaped with serious gunshot injuries and abandoned the victim and his car.

‘’Having rescued the victim, the Commissioner of Police, CP Frank Mba ordered a massive manhunt for the fleeing suspects, and in compliance with the CP’s directive, the SP Taiwo Opadiran led team embarked on technical and intelligence based investigation which led to the arrest of Temidayo Oladimeji who was the one detailed to guard the victim in the bush while the two others were waiting for the ransome. Immediately he discovered that his other colleagues had been injured, he abandoned their victim and ran away. Luck however ran against him when he was traced to his hideout in Ijebu-ode where he was apprehended.’ Oyeyemi statement read in part

He said that items recovered from him include a locally-made pistol and a live cartridge.
